The Power of Mindfulness and Meditation

Mindfulness and meditation serve as foundational practices at Life Springs, offering participants tools to cultivate awareness and presence in their daily lives. Mindfulness involves paying attention to the present moment without judgment, allowing individuals to observe their thoughts and feelings with clarity. This practice can lead to reduced stress, improved emotional regulation, and enhanced overall well-being.

At Life Springs, participants are guided through various mindfulness exercises that encourage them to anchor themselves in the here and now. Meditation complements mindfulness by providing a structured way to quiet the mind and foster inner peace. Through guided sessions led by experienced instructors, participants learn different meditation techniques, such as breath awareness, loving-kindness meditation, and body scans.

These practices not only promote relaxation but also enhance self-awareness and emotional resilience. By incorporating mindfulness and meditation into their daily routines, individuals can develop a greater sense of control over their thoughts and emotions, paving the way for deeper self-understanding.

Overcoming Obstacles: Tools for Personal Growth and Development

Life Springs equips participants with practical tools for overcoming obstacles that may hinder personal growth and development. Through workshops focused on goal-setting, resilience-building, and problem-solving strategies, attendees learn how to navigate challenges with confidence. These sessions often include interactive exercises that encourage individuals to identify their obstacles and brainstorm actionable steps toward overcoming them.

One effective tool introduced at Life Springs is the practice of reframing negative thoughts. Participants are guided through cognitive restructuring techniques that help them shift their perspectives on challenges. By learning to view obstacles as opportunities for growth rather than insurmountable barriers, individuals can cultivate a more positive mindset.

This shift in thinking not only empowers participants but also fosters resilience, enabling them to face future challenges with greater ease.
